The word "impudent" means that you are loud, brash, bold and cocky while being impolite. It means to "have an attitude" and does not really fit with "not greeting friends". Maybe "uncouth" or "rude" is better - these mean not civil or impolite.
I'm a little uncouth because I don't often greet my friends.
In the second sentence, the word "they" is ambiguous - it could refer to either the people or the parents. A better phrasing is:
I execrate those people who, when they have grown up (or "become independent adults"), abandon their parents.
